Working as part of the Global Mobility team, the Mobility Tax Specialist will assist the Global Mobility Tax Team in the coordination of International and Domestic Assignment tax and payroll issues for Hatch’s global assignee population within the North America region.

Close interaction and consulting with key stakeholders including HR, Finance, Payroll, business unit leaders and assignees.


What will you do:

  • Review cost estimates in relation to the projected tax costs of assignments for the assignees in North America;
  • Prepare applications for Certificate of Coverage and other required tax forms in the life cycle of assignees;
  • Assist in the year-end payroll review and reconciliation process for the assignees in North America and prepare the required tax adjustments to compensation;
  • Coordinate and assist in shadow payroll reporting and ensure payroll data reported is accurate and complete;
  • Prepare/review tax reconciliations as required;
  • Respond to payroll and tax related queries from employees or other key stakeholders;
  • Review and analyze revenue and costs associated with international and domestic assignments;
  • Research of tax laws and planning opportunities for a cost and tax effective assignment structure of Hatch’s global assignee population;
  • May provide general taxation advice to employees as it relates to their International or Domestic assignments;
  • Review and/or assist with the processing of invoices from tax service providers;
  • Carry out ad hoc tasks and analysis, as required;
  • Assist in the coordination of third party services relating to tax advice and tax return preparation for Hatch assignees;
  • Work closely with Payroll and Accounting to maintain efficient systems and processes for the administration of international and domestic assignments.

What you bring to the role:

Key Criteria:

  • Minimum of 5-7 years in expatriate taxation and some expatriate payroll knowledge;
  • Demonstrated experience in dealing with and advising on the taxation of Canadian and US employees’ inpatriate and expatriate assignments;
  • Understanding of tax treaty application;
  • Cross border payroll understanding;
  • Experience in local and foreign compensation;
  • Intermediate to advanced knowledge of Excel;
  • Highly developed analytical skills and the ability to identify and deal with complex tax and payroll issues;
  • Exceptional attention to detail and accuracy;
  • Demonstrates initiative and a positive attitude centered around client service;
  • Ability to work independently as well as part of a team;
  • Good written and oral communication skills;
  • Good interpersonal skills;
  • Sound time management and prioritization skills;
  • Self-motivated.

Qualifications:

  • Direct work experience with expatriate taxation and cross border payroll is essential;
  • Professional Accounting Designation and Accounting/Business degree preferred;
  • Detailed knowledge of Canadian taxation system, in particular the foreign income provisions is essential;
  • Working knowledge of other country’s tax systems an asset;
  • Previous experience working with Engineering Services Industry is desirable, although not essential.
